Company Overview

Navarro’s Travel Service Limited is one of Trinidad and Tobago’s most established and trusted travel management companies, proudly serving clients for over half a century. Since our early beginnings and formal incorporation in 1985, we’ve built a reputation for exceptional service, reliability, and a personalized approach to travel.

As a long-standing member of IATA and a partner of American Express Global Business Travel (Amex GBT), we combine global reach with local expertise, offering our clients world-class technology, corporate travel management tools such as Amadeus and Concur, and a dedicated team that ensures every trip is seamless from start to finish.

Led by Chairman and Managing Director Philip Navarro, CFO Gail Aleong, and General Manager Ian Corbie, our team brings together more than seven decades of combined industry experience. Our History

Our Legacy

1920s — Foundations of the Navarro Brand

Antonio Navarro Sr. moves to Trinidad to work for Escala & Navarro, a shipping and brokerage partnership that marks the beginning of the Navarro family’s business legacy.

1960s — From Sea to Sky

After Mr. Escala’s departure in 1958, the company continues under a different name, Navarro’s Shipping & Brokerage Ltd. In 1962, with the opening of the first terminal at Piarco International Airport, the family began doing Cargo handling in partnership with PasCargo.

1970s — The Start of Leisure Travel

Navarro’s agents begin organizing trips for leisure travellers, with Venezuela, particularly Caracas, becoming a top destination for culture, shopping, and entertainment. All bookings are done manually, by phone and handwritten ledgers.

1980s — A Trusted Name in Travel

Now one of Trinidad’s most respected agencies, Navarro’s introduces early booking system, Sabre, modernizing operations while maintaining meticulous manual processes to ensure accuracy. In 1985 we became officially incorporated under the Navarro’s Travel Service Ltd. name that we are known by today. The Navarro brothers’ strong business relationships and natural communication skills help the company attract major corporate clients in the oil, manufacturing, banking, and insurance sectors.

1990s — Digital Connections

With the rise of the World Wide Web and email, Navarro’s becomes more connected than ever, expanding its network of corporate and leisure travelers and enhancing client communication.

2000s — Dual Systems, Steady Growth

The company continues operating Sabre and introduces a new program, Amadeus, which operate simultaneously to ensure the most reliable, flexible, and competitive booking experience for all clients.

Late 2010s — A Global Partnership

Navarro’s becomes the exclusive local partner of American Express Global Business Travel (Amex GBT), elevating its corporate travel capabilities and offering clients global reach and advanced tools like Concur.

2020s — Rebuilding & Reimagining

Following the challenges of the COVID-19 pandemic, Navarro’s Travel strengthens its digital presence and social media engagement, continuing to uphold its family values of service, honesty, and excellence while embracing the modern travel landscape.
